Here’s something you don’t get to see every day: Matt Damon and Michael Douglas in full makeup, wigs and the flashiest, most fabulous outfits we’ve seen this year, sharing an embrace – as pictured on the cover of the latest issue of Entertainment Weekly. The two are promoting HBO’s “Behind the Candelabra.”

Described by the publication as “one of the weirdest, glitziest gay love stories ever put on film,” the film was turned down by various studios for being “too gay” before it was picked up by HBO.

Michael and Matt jumped at the chance of portraying Liberace and his lover Scott Thorson, on whose book the film is based on. Of course, they knew they would be in a world of firsts with this project.

In the EW interview, the actors talk about doing love scenes (of which there are plenty) together, getting tans and makeup, and the kind of research they had to do to bring to life one of the most colorful couples (though not officially, of course) in showbiz.

Directed by Steven Soderbergh, “Behind the Candelabra” has a tentative premiere date for Spring 2013.
